WebAverage preimplantation genetic testing costs in the US. IVF costs – in the US the average cost for IVF with ICSI is about $12,000 to $13,000. The average cost for in vitro fertilization medications is $5000 to $7000. Embryo biopsy charges are about $1500 to $2200. For single gene defects (such as cystic fibrosis), there are additional costs ... WebApr 10, 2024 · Mosaic embryos, which are embryos with a mixture of genetically normal and abnormal cells occur quite frequently and commonly among woman undergoing IVF. Genetic testing often leads to the misdiagnosis and discarding of mosaic embryos, which have been shown to be capable of giving rise to a normal and healthy baby.
